About Small tangerine

Small tangerines are citrus fruits known for their vibrant orange color, sweet flavor, and easy-to-peel skin. Originating from Southeast Asia, these fruits are popular in global cuisines and often enjoyed fresh, juiced, or added to salads and desserts. They are a rich source of vitamin C, which supports immune health and skin vitality, as well as dietary fiber, promoting digestive health. Tangerines also contain essential nutrients like potassium, folate, and small amounts of vitamin A, which contribute to heart health and cell function. Low in calories and naturally sweet, they are a healthy snack option that can satisfy sugar cravings while providing hydration due to their high water content. However, as with all fruits, moderation is key for individuals monitoring sugar intake. Small tangerines are a refreshing and nutritious addition to a balanced diet, offering both flavor and functional benefits.
